PROCEDIMENTOS: Carregar arquivos em um servidor Web usando o FrontPage 2002

Traduções deste artigo Traduções deste artigo
ID do artigo: 299763 - Exibir os produtos aos quais esse artigo se aplica.
Este artigo foi publicado anteriormente em BR299763
Expandir tudo | Recolher tudo

Neste artigo

Sumário

Este guia passo a passo mostra como usar o Microsoft FrontPage 2002 para desenvolver rapidamente uma página de carregamento efetiva que permita que vários arquivos de qualquer tipo sejam carregados ao mesmo tempo a partir do navegador da Web.

Hardware e software necessários

  • Um dos seguintes sistemas operacionais:
    • Microsoft Windows 2000 Server
    • Microsoft Windows 2000 Advanced Server
    • Microsoft Windows 2000 Professional
  • Microsoft Internet Information Server 5.0 (IIS)
  • Extensões de servidor do Microsoft FrontPage 2002 instaladas e configuradas no IIS. Para obter e fazer o download das Extensões de servidor do FrontPage, visite o seguinte site da Microsoft na Web:
    http://msdn2.microsoft.com/en-us/library/aa140185(office.10).aspx
  • FrontPage 2002 instalado no computador de desenvolvimento. (O FrontPage está disponível como uma versão autônoma no Microsoft Office XP Professional Special Edition.)
  • Uma conexão estabelecida de rede ou Internet com o servidor Web.
  • Um projeto da Web criado no servidor Web e aberto para edição.

Criando a página de carregamento


  1. Inicie o Microsoft FrontPage. Para isso, aponte para Programas no menu Iniciar e clique em Microsoft FrontPage.
  2. Crie ou abra uma Web.

    Para criar uma nova Web, siga estas etapas:

    1. No menu Arquivo, aponte para Novo e clique em Página ou Web.
    2. No painel de tarefas Nova página ou Web, clique em Web vazia.
    3. Na caixa de diálogo Modelos de site da Web, clique no ícone Web vazia e clique em OK.
    Para abrir uma Web existente, clique em Abrir Web no menu Arquivo. Na caixa de diálogo Abrir Web, selecione a Web que deseja abrir e clique em Abrir.
  3. No menu Exibir, clique em Página.
  4. No menu Arquivo, aponte para Novo e clique em Página ou Web. No painel de tarefas Nova página ou Web, clique em Página em branco para criar uma nova página HTML.
  5. No menu Arquivo, clique em Salvar. Atribua ao arquivo o nome Upload.htm e clique em Salvar. A página será exibida no painel Lista de pastas e também será aberta para edição.
  6. No menu Exibir, clique em Pastas. No menu Arquivo, aponte para Novo e clique em Pasta. Uma nova pasta será exibida na Web. O cursor é colocado no local para digitação do nome da pasta. Digite Carregamentos e pressione ENTER.
  7. Clique com o botão direito do mouse na nova pasta e clique em Propriedades no menu exibido. Na caixa de diálogo Propriedades, desmarque a caixa de seleção Permitir que os scripts ou programas sejam executados. Certifique-se de que as demais caixas de seleção estão marcadas. Clique em OK.

    OBSERVAÇÃO: se as caixas de seleção estiverem sombreadas, verifique se você abriu ou criou uma Web. No modo de exibição de pasta, o primeiro item no painel Lista de pastas deve mostrar um URL (http://...) e não um caminho de arquivo (C:\...).
  8. No menu Exibir, clique em Página para editar a página Upload.htm recentemente criada. Alterne para o modo de exibição normal, se necessário, clicando em Normal na parte inferior da janela do FrontPage.

Configurando o formulário de carregamento de arquivo

  1. Clique no local onde deseja posicionar o formulário Carregamento de arquivo. No menu Inserir, aponte para Formulários e clique em Carregamento de arquivo.

    Será exibido um formulário na página e o cursor será posicionado entre os botões Procurar e Enviar. Pressione ENTER várias vezes para adicionar algum espaço em branco entre o controle Carregamento de arquivo e o botão Enviar. Para permitir carregamentos simultâneos de vários arquivos, clique no formulário novamente e insira controles Carregamento de arquivo adicionais.
  2. Para alterar o rótulo do botão Enviar, clique com o botão direito do mouse nele e clique em Propriedades do campo de formulário no menu exibido. Na caixa Valor/título, digite Carregar e clique em OK.
  3. Clique com o botão direito do mouse em qualquer lugar do formulário e clique em Propriedades do formulário no menu exibido.
  4. Selecione a opção Enviar para.
  5. Clique em Opções.
  6. Na caixa de diálogo Salvar resultados, clique na guia Carregamento de arquivo.
  7. Clique em Procurar.
  8. Na caixa de diálogo Web atual, clique na pasta Carregamentos.
  9. Clique em OK três vez para voltar para o formulário.
  10. No menu Arquivo, clique em Salvar para salvar a página atualizada.

Testando a página

  1. Para testar a página, clique em Visualizar no navegador, no menu Arquivo. A página Upload.htm será aberta no navegador da Web.
  2. Clique em Procurar, selecione o arquivo a ser carregado do disco rígido para o servidor Web e clique em Abrir.
  3. Clique no botão Carregar (ou Enviar ).

    O arquivo será carregado na pasta Carregamentos do servidor Web. Você verá uma confirmação de que o arquivo foi carregado com êxito.
Quando você tiver esse exemplo de carregamento anônimo funcionando, poderá aprimorá-lo ainda mais, criando uma página de confirmação personalizada ou poderá carregar o documento em um banco de dados em vez de em uma pasta. Para obter informações adicionais, consulte os artigos listados na seção "Referências", mais adiante, neste artigo.

Também é possível ativar autenticação, limitar o acesso aos arquivos, registrar a atividade de carregamento em um banco de dados e exibir pastas dos documentos carregados e suas propriedades para os usuários que desejam procurar, editar ou carregar arquivos. Essa solução de carregamento também funciona em outros programas ASP criados com ferramentas que não sejam o FrontPage, desde que os projetos estejam em um servidor Windows 2000 que tenha as Extensões de servidor do FrontPage 2002 configuradas corretamente.

Solução de problemas

  • Lembre-se de que a solução Carregamento de arquivo é limitada, pois não é possível estender os recursos do componente de carregamento. No entanto, é possível definir uma página de confirmação personalizada ou criar uma página de "resultados" baseada no ASP, que insira campos em um banco de dados ou que faça outro processamento personalizado. Portanto, embora o código do componente seja fixo, é possível criar novo código personalizado com relação ao componente para realizar as tarefas necessárias.
  • Para usar uma solução WebDav, é preciso desinstalar as Extensões de servidor do FrontPage 2002 do IIS. Para obter informações adicionais, clique no número a seguir para exibir o artigo do Microsoft Knowledge Base:
    221600 Working with Distributed Authoring and Versioning (DAV) and Web Folders
    O WebDAV é um novo conjunto de extensões para o protocolo HTTP e permite criação e versão distribuídas. Ele está ativado no Windows 2000 e no IIS 5, no formato de Pastas da Web, e pode ser acessado no Office 2000 e no Internet Explorer 5.0 ou posterior ou em soluções codificadas personalizadas.
  • Embora sejam normalmente confiáveis assim que instaladas, as Extensões de servidor do FrontPage exigem configuração inicial. No entanto, você poderá ter problemas de acesso ou utilização no site se a configuração for afetada por alterações nas definições ou pelo software que está sendo instalado no servidor. Como as Extensões de servidor do FrontPage são uma tecnologia desenvolvida, os problemas com elas são normalmente resolvidos rapidamente e elas ativam vários recursos convenientes e poderosos em vários produtos Microsoft. Por exemplo, o Visual Interdev usa as extensões para criar e administrar remotamente aplicativos da Web no IIS.

REFERÊNCIAS

Para obter mais informações, clique nos números a seguir para exibir os artigos do Microsoft Knowledge Base:
288328 FP2002: White Paper: How to Send Form Results to a Database and an E-mail Recipient and Use the File Upload Component Simultaneously
281532 FP2002: Features That Require FrontPage Server Extensions 2002
221600 Working with Distributed Authoring and Versioning (DAV) and Web Folders
294826 FPSE2002: How to Install the FrontPage Server Extensions in Quiet Mode
269647 FP2002: FrontPage Extensions Are Not Upgraded During Setup

Recursos de terceiros para componentes de carregamento

Você pode encontrar componentes de carregamento de terceiros nos seguintes sites da Web:
MSN

15 Seconds Resource List

Persits Soptware Inc.

Advantys

SoftArtisans

Componentes de terceiros gratuitos

Uploading Multiple Files from 15 Seconds

aspSmartUpload from aspSmart

ABCUpload from WebSuperGoo

Propriedades

ID do artigo: 299763 - Última revisão: quarta-feira, 17 de janeiro de 2007 - Revisão: 3.1
A informação contida neste artigo aplica-se a:
  • Microsoft FrontPage 2002 Standard Edition
  • Microsoft Internet Information Services 5.0
Palavras-chave: 
kbconfig kbctrl kbdeployment kbdta kbfpservx kbfrontpage kbgrpdsasp kbhowto kbhowtomaster kbsecurity kbserver kbsetup KB299763

Submeter comentários

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com